# Break-Glass Access: Queue Migration Review

This page covers emergency access during the replacement of Cinderhall's homegrown job queue with the new Ravelwork scheduler. As the assigned code reviewer, you may need break-glass rights if a migration batch stalls and both queues desync. Access is logged, time-boxed to two hours, and requires a second approver from the platform rotation. Use it only when normal deploy tooling is unavailable. To activate the break-glass session, supply the recovery passphrase given below.

vault phrase of bagaf-kajeg = jorath-feniel-briir-siliel-ralix

# Break-Glass: Catalog Cache Invalidation

Scope: the Pinrow product catalog at Veldstone Retail. If stale prices persist after a purge and the Hollowmere invalidation queue is wedged, use break-glass to flush the edge tier directly. Contractors: get verbal sign-off from the catalog lead first. Steps: open the Hollowmere admin shell, select emergency-flush, confirm the tenant, and run it once — repeated flushes thrash the origin. Access is logged and expires after 20 minutes. Unseal the admin shell with the passphrase below.

recovery phrase for kahop-tajog: istix-casvan

Leadership Review Briefing — Branch Managers

Warranty costs on the Kestrel pump line ran 38% over plan last quarter. Root cause: seal failures in units built at the Dunmarsh plant. Containment is in place; rework schedule attached. Hold all customer goodwill credits pending central approval. The confidential plan addressing this overrun follows below.

board note of tawip-hahip: Only 7 of the 80 pilot accounts renewed Ralath, so a churn review is set for April 1.

# Heads up, support folks: this module drives the nightly catalogue import
# from the Pellworth library feed into Shelfhound. If a batch stalls, it's
# almost always a malformed record count in the feed header, not our parser.
# You can safely re-run a failed batch — dedupe is keyed on accession number,
# so nothing doubles up. Don't change the throttle values without pinging the
# data team; the feed host rate-limits us hard. The constants below are the
# knobs they'll ask about first.

tuning table, kajog-bawip:
TIERS = {
    "kelius": 256,
    "lammir": 543,
}